instead of school and work my daughter an family were home when a mother duck got bullied by another and flew off from their pond. The other ducks started to attack the ducklings left behind which were only a few says old. Dad and daughters were in the pond waist deep while my daughter overlooked the rescue operation and gleefully said she only got a boot full of water where the others went in fully clothed.. (Its a big pond) Erin the youngest aged 14 is now mother to them and they sleep in her bedroom at night under a heat lamp I have and they have a compound in the garden with a nice pond for then to swim in.. As this all happened two days ago and luckily I can now go and see them as we are a bubble family with the covid 19 rules as of the 13th I went over with my camera... There are 6 in total.. They are not fully water proof yet so one or two have to be warmed up after a swim and its such a hard job to cuddle them to warm them up..
